鸿蒙征文|探索鸿蒙操作系统的创新之路
随着信息技术的飞速发展,操作系统作为计算机系统的核心和灵魂,其重要性不言而喻。近年来,随着国家对信息技术自主可控的重视,国产操作系统的研发和推广逐渐成为行业焦点。鸿蒙操作系统(HarmonyOS)作为中国自主研发的操作系统,自问世以来便受到了广泛关注。本文旨在深入探讨鸿蒙操作系统的创新特点、技术优势以及未来发展趋势,为广大技术爱好者和行业同仁提供一份详实的技术分析和实践总结。
鸿蒙操作系统的创新特点
1. 分布式架构设计 鸿蒙操作系统采用了全新的分布式架构设计,使得应用程序能够在不同的设备和平台上无缝协同工作。这种设计大大提高了系统的扩展性和兼容性,为多设备互联互通提供了可能。
2. 微内核设计:鸿蒙操作系统采用了微内核设计,相比于传统的宏内核,微内核更加轻量级,安全性更高。微内核只包含最基础的服务,其他服务都以模块化的形式运行在用户空间,这大大降低了系统的复杂性和潜在的安全风险。
3. IDEA加密算法:鸿蒙操作系统内置了国产的IDEA加密算法,这是一种对称加密算法,具有较高的安全性和效率。通过使用国产加密算法,鸿蒙操作系统在保障数据安全的同时,也推动了国产密码技术的发展和应用。
技术优势
1. 跨平台能力:鸿蒙操作系统支持跨平台开发,无论是手机、平板、电视还是车载系统,开发者可以使用统一的开发框架和语言进行应用开发,大大提高了开发效率和降低了开发成本。
2. 性能优化:鸿蒙操作系统在性能方面进行了大量优化,包括内存管理、任务调度等多个方面。这些优化使得鸿蒙操作系统在保证流畅性的同时,也能够有效降低功耗,延长设备使用时间。
3. 生态兼容性:鸿蒙操作系统具有良好的生态兼容性,不仅支持安卓应用,还能够兼容各种Linux应用。这为用户和开发者提供了更多的选择和便利。
实践总结与未来展望
在实际使用和开发过程中,鸿蒙操作系统展现出了强大的生命力和潜力。开发者社区的活跃、官方文档的完善以及不断更新的API和工具,都为鸿蒙操作系统的发展提供了坚实的基础。
未来,鸿蒙操作系统有望在物联网、智能家居、工业自动化等多个领域发挥更大的作用,成为推动中国信息化发展的重要力量。
总之,鸿蒙操作系统的推出不仅是中国信息技术自主可控的一个缩影,更是国家软实力的体现。随着技术的不断进步和生态的日益完善,我们有理由相信,鸿蒙操作系统将在未来的操作系统市场中占据一席之地,为全球用户带来更加丰富和安全的产品体验。